Polls Open for Today’s Statewide Direct Primary Election

Polls are open across the City for today’s statewide primary election

More than 4,147 polling places across Los Angeles County are now open and ready for voters, according to Los Angeles County Registrar-Recorder/County Clerk (RR/CC) Dean C. Logan.

It’s a very full ballot with 117 office contests and 527 candidates. Two highly anticipated contests on the ballot this year include those for Governor and US Senate. There are 27 candidates running for California Governor. In the U.S. Senate contest, there are 32 candidates. Both contests will be listed on two ballot pages so be sure to keep turning the page to find the candidate you want to vote for.

To find your polling place:

  • Text the word “VOTE” or “VOTO” to 468683.
  • Visit lavote.net
  • Look at the back of your Sample Ballot
  • Call (800) 815-2666, option 1.

Polls opened at 7 a.m. and will close at 8 p.m.

Vote by Mail voters can drop off their VBM ballot at any polling place or at the Norwalk RR/CC Headquarters: 12400 Imperial Hwy., Norwalk, CA 90650.
